The individual plays a key role in implementing and advancing Bastian Solutions’ sustainability initiatives, focusing on reducing the company’s environmental footprint and promoting sustainable business practices across all operations. This role involves close collaboration with multiple departments and stakeholders to ensure sustainability is integrated into business objectives. The position will also work frequently with sister companies within the Toyota Industrial Corporation network, supporting global alignment on environmental goals and best practices. The role requires supporting multiple sites and performing work under minimal supervision. Projects are generally large and complex in scope, with impact at departmental, divisional, and corporate levels. Handles complex issues and refers only the most critical matters to others.

Job Responsibilities

  • Support sustainability management initiatives, including CO₂ inventory and reduction strategies, energy conservation measures, recycling programs, tracking contaminants of concern, community service events, and ESG reporting efforts.
  • Maintain awareness of evolving standards, compliance deadlines, and enforcement priorities.
  • Maintain accurate records of sustainability data and compliance activities.
  • Collect, analyze, and report ESG and sustainability metrics to internal and external stakeholders.
  • Ensure compliance with applicable ESG regulations and standards.
  • Conduct market research and competitive analysis to identify ESG factors impacting business activity.
  • Uphold corporate sustainability commitments and implement best practices across Bastian Solutions.
  • Evaluate and select third-party sustainability service providers or vendors as needed.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to reduce waste, promote recycling and circularity, and manage resources efficiently.
  • Identify and implement energy efficiency programs and renewable energy solutions.
  • Prepare and deliver reports on environmental performance, including sustainability metrics and progress.
  • Create internal policies and procedures to ensure adherence to environmental laws and corporate sustainability goals.
  • Develop and participate in sustainability awareness campaigns, training, and workshops for employees and stakeholders.
  • Communicate programs and policies effectively through print and oral communication channels.
  • Perform related work as assigned.
  • Regular attendance in the workplace is required for interaction with others and to support teamwork.
  • Coordinate with global teams across Toyota Industries Corporation to ensure consistency in sustainability goals and reporting.
  • Participate in virtual meetings with international stakeholders and occasional travel to Japan or other global locations may be required for strategic alignment and project execution.
  • Strong knowledge of environmental regulations and sustainability reporting standards (e.g., GRI, CDP, ISO 14001).
  • Proficiency in data collection, analysis, and environmental performance software.
  • Strong foundation in carbon reduction strategies.
  • Requires excellent interpersonal, communication, listening, and negotiation skills.
  • Requires excellent analytical/research, problem-solving, organizational, and project management skills with a sense of urgency.
  • High attention to detail with ability to multi-task, prioritize, and work in a fast-paced environment; must be self-directed.
  • Must be able to communicate effectively at all organizational levels.
  • Requires excellent computer skills, including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Ability to work in a constant state of alertness and safe manner.
  • Additional duties as assigned.

Travel Requirements

  • Travel to Project Sites up to 10%

Preferred Skills And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in ESG/Sustainability, Environmental Science, or a related field required.
  • Experience in a manufacturing and/or warehouse environment preferred.
  • ESG credentials or certificates, particularly from reporting entities like GRI, CDP, or Sustainalytics, preferred.
  • Entry-level to four years of ESG/Sustainability experience required.

About Bastian Solutions

Bastian Solutions, a Toyota Automated Logistics company, is an independent material handling and robotics system integrator providing automated solutions for distribution, manufacturing, and order fulfillment centers around the world. Our team specializes in consulting, system design, project management, maintenance, and installation, while sourcing the best equipment and automation technology. We take great pride in providing exceptional service and flexibility to our customers.
